The Science Behind Light Bulbs

The science of light bulbs revolves around several key concepts, including lumens, watts, and color temperature. Lumens measure the amount of light emitted, while watts quantify the energy consumed. The interplay between lumens and watts is critical for determining energy efficiency, a factor that consumers increasingly prioritize. For instance, while a traditional incandescent bulb might produce around 800 lumens using 60 watts, an LED bulb can achieve the same brightness with only 10-12 watts, showcasing the remarkable efficiency of modern lighting technologies.

Color temperature, measured in Kelvin, describes the warmth or coolness of the light emitted. Cooler light can enhance focus and productivity, while warmer light fosters a relaxing atmosphere. Understanding these scientific principles aids consumers in selecting the right type of light bulb for their needs. For example, a color temperature of 5000K is often preferred in workspaces for its daylight-like quality, while a cozy 2700K is ideal for living rooms and bedrooms, creating a soothing environment conducive to relaxation.

Different Types of Light Bulbs

There are several types of light bulbs available on the market today, each with unique characteristics. Traditional incandescent bulbs are known for their warm glow but lack energy efficiency. Compact fluorescent lamps (CFLs) are more energy-efficient, using a fraction of the power to produce the same amount of light. However, they can take time to warm up and may not be suitable for all fixtures.

Light-emitting diodes (LEDs) have emerged as one of the most popular options due to their long life span and energy efficiency.
